Chongqing Iron & Steel Company Limited (CGP) recorded a net asset momentum of -16.2% as of December 2025, with net assets of €13.91 Billion EUR. Net Asset Momentum measures the year-over-year percentage change in net assets (total assets minus total liabilities), indicating how rapidly the company is building or eroding its equity base. Annual Net Asset History for Chongqing Iron & Steel Company Limited (2013–2025)

The table below shows the complete annual net asset history for Chongqing Iron & Steel Company Limited from 2013 to 2025, covering 13 yearly periods. Each row includes total assets, total liabilities, net assets, and the year-over-year momentum figure for that period. Year Net Assets (EUR) Total Assets Total Liabilities YoY Momentum
2025 €13.91 Billion €32.09 Billion €18.17 Billion ▼ -16.2%
2024 €16.61 Billion €35.48 Billion €18.87 Billion ▼ -16.4%
2023 €19.85 Billion €37.36 Billion €17.50 Billion ▼ -7.0%
2022 €21.34 Billion €39.36 Billion €18.02 Billion ▼ -4.6%
2021 €22.38 Billion €43.00 Billion €20.62 Billion ▲ +11.7%
2020 €20.04 Billion €39.95 Billion €19.91 Billion ▲ +3.3%
2019 €19.40 Billion €26.98 Billion €7.58 Billion ▲ +4.7%
2018 €18.53 Billion €26.93 Billion €8.40 Billion ▲ +10.3%
2017 €16.80 Billion €25.01 Billion €8.21 Billion ▲ +15741.2%
2016 €-107.43 Million €36.44 Billion €36.55 Billion ▼ -102.7%
2015 €4.01 Billion €39.23 Billion €35.22 Billion ▼ -59.9%
2014 €9.99 Billion €47.15 Billion €37.16 Billion ▲ +0.6%
2013 €9.94 Billion €48.05 Billion €38.11 Billion
